''It's our only option.'' She said confidently- or more like attempted to sound confidently. When in reality, she sounded anything but confident about this. ''They built their entire case on my testimony, for some reason. They can't subpoena me if we're..'' She trailed off. She just couldn't say it. ''Married.'' Levi finished for her. When high end defense attorney, Valentina Amello, meets high up his ass prosecutor, Levi Greyson, she discovers new limits to arrogance. With a fear of commitment and past still hounting her, she's careful to let anyone in. Caught up in a wager, Valentina finds herself in the biggest commitment known to her. Marriage.
